Lots of nations have a notion of basic or adhering home loans that define a viewed acceptable level of risk, which might be official or casual, and might be strengthened by laws, federal government intervention, or market practice. For instance, a standard home loan may be thought about to be one without any more than 7080% LTV and no greater than one-third of gross income going to mortgage financial obligation.

In the United States, a conforming home mortgage is one which meets the recognized rules and procedures of the two major government-sponsored entities in the housing financing market (including some legal requirements). On the other hand, lending institutions who choose to make nonconforming loans are exercising a higher threat tolerance and do so knowing that they deal with more difficulty in reselling the loan.

Controlled loan providers (such as banks) may go through limitations or higher-risk newton group timeshare complaints weightings for non-standard home mortgages. For example, banks and home mortgage brokerages in Canada deal with constraints on providing more than 80% of the property worth; beyond this level, home loan insurance coverage is usually needed. In some countries with currencies that tend to depreciate, foreign currency home mortgages prevail, making it possible for loan providers to provide in a stable foreign currency, whilst the debtor takes on the currency threat that the currency will depreciate and they will for that reason require to convert higher amounts of the domestic currency to pay back the loan.

Certain details might specify to different locations: interest might be computed on the basis of a 360-day year, for example; interest might be intensified daily, annual, or semi-annually; prepayment penalties may use; and other factors. There may be legal restrictions on certain matters, and consumer defense laws may define or forbid specific practices.

In the UK and U.S., 25 to thirty years is the normal optimum term (although much shorter periods, such as 15-year home loan, prevail). Mortgage payments, which are normally made regular monthly, include a payment of the principal and an interest aspect. The quantity approaching the principal in each payment varies throughout the term of the home loan.

With this arrangement regular contributions are made to a different financial investment strategy designed to develop a lump sum to pay back the home mortgage at maturity. This type of plan is called an investment-backed home loan or is typically related to the kind of strategy used: endowment home loan if an endowment policy is used, likewise a individual equity strategy (PEP) home mortgage, Individual Cost Savings Account (ISA) home mortgage or pension home loan.

Investment-backed home mortgages are seen as higher risk as they depend on the financial investment making adequate return to clear the financial obligation.
